    United Nations: An Iraqi person wastes 120 kg of food annually

    08:52 - 10/03/2021


    [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.]
     
    The information / Baghdad ..
    A UN report revealed that [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.] ranks second in food waste after [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.] , indicating that the annual value of food per capita Iraqi wastes is 120 kg.
    The report issued by the United Nations Environment Program stated that 931 million tons of food are thrown into waste around the world annually, 64% of which is wasted from homes, while the average annual per capita waste of food around the world is about 74 kg.
    The wasted food index stated that 17% of food intended for consumption in stores, homes and restaurants goes to waste bins, and 64% of that wasted food comes from homes.
    [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.] came in second place in the average per capita waste of food annually by 120 kg, followed by Saudi Arabia with 105 kg, then Lebanon with 105 kg, followed by Sudan with 97, Kuwait, Oman, Qatar and the Emirates with 95, then Jordan with 93, and then Algeria, Egypt, Morocco and Tunisia with 91 kg each. End / 25
